Description

For the Neptune Jar, Mariadela has designed an amphora, inspired by blue tones, and created a fluid piece. This piece is made with a structure within the classic canons of basketry, but manipulated with traditional tapestry weaving stitches. As usual in her work, the designer likes to push the limits of the tapestry technique to create utilitarian objects.

Materials : different cotton cords, bambú
Technique : hand woven contemporary basketry

About Mariadela Araujo Studio Visit Showroom →

Mariadela Araujo is a Venezuelan-Spanish artist, designer and educator based in Barcelona and working internationally. From her studio–laboratory she researches, experiments and creates artworks, functional objects and large-scale installations, using diverse textile materials and bold color palettes. Her practice elevates traditional artisan techniques such as weaving, embroidery and textile assembly, reimagined through a contemporary lens. Challenging the boundaries between art and design, her work explores materiality, beauty and contrast, often merging natural and industrial materials in unexpected combinations. She finds beauty in juxtaposition and in the unexpected, positioning her creations at the crossroads of functional and decorative, traditional and contemporary. Recognized by AD Magazine Spain as one of the best Spanish designers, Mariadela has developed projects for Loewe, Saatchi Art, EÈRA, WeWork, Limited Edition Rugs, Casa Aymat, and has been featured in leading design platforms such as Maison & Objet, Première Vision, Affordable Art Fair Amsterdam and Fuorisalone Milano. Her work has been exhibited across Europe and beyond, including Brussels, Paris, Barcelona, Rotterdam, Amsterdam, Mallorca, Caracas and Yerevan, consolidating her voice as a creator who expands the possibilities of textiles within both the art and design worlds.
